## Further reading

Bulk edits in the Marrowtab admin table are powerful and slightly terrifying — one bad filter and you've updated 40k rows. Always dry-run first (the preview diff is your friend), and remember bulk ops bypass row-level validation, so the usual guardrails don't apply. If you're on call and someone pings you about a botched bulk edit, the rollback snapshots keep 72 hours of history. The full bulk-edit playbook, gotchas included, lives on this page.

runbook for tafof-yawif: https://confluence.tolvaqsys.internal/display/display/browse/pages/7be3

Visiting contractors may use the quiet room on the top floor of Thorncliff House for calls and focused work only. No meetings, no food, phones on silent. The room is unbookable; first come, first served. Leave it as found. Contractors must sign in at reception before heading up. The door is keypad-locked; enter with the code below.

door code, yahif-yagag: bdg-FKXEAK-64235764

## Runbook: RBAC on Fernwick Wiki

Roles: reader, editor, steward. Stewards can alter page ACLs; editors cannot. Role grants flow through the Gatehouse service — never edit the wiki DB directly. Audit logs ship nightly to Ledgerline. To verify a grant, query Gatehouse's /roles endpoint and diff against the access matrix in the steward handbook. Gatehouse requires authenticated calls; use the key below for review queries.

gateway credential: kto3_qfe

## Authentication

FormulaCage evaluates user-supplied spreadsheet formulas inside an isolated interpreter with no filesystem or network access. The sandbox broker, however, must call our internal Vetting service to verify formula signatures before execution, and that call is authenticated. Release builds must never embed the staging credential; the packaging script reads the production value from the sealed config at build time. For the release manager's verification step, the current production key is reproduced directly below this paragraph.

gateway credential: kto7_GoY89Me